As The Dark of Winter Approaches...

11/18/2016

0 Comments

 
  One thing about living on a farm, you get to know the weather very well. Right now the wind outside (not this big wind inside) is roaring, and with it comes cooler temps. Nothing comforts me more than playing records. My vinyl collection gives me that earthy, tangible feel that keeps me connected to nature, without being out there. I suppose if I were a string player, I'd have my cello or fiddle outside, on nice days anway, and bow away. I see videos of the new classical stars, like Charlie Siem/violin, Andy Ottensamer/clarinet and Milos Karadaglic/classical guitar, always playing outside with great scenery around them. So I'm not the only one who still equates nature and music. I'm told my great grandfather used to play his victrola outside here. 
  Trouble is, my present victrola, at 125 lbs.,  is a two person job.....
